  • Excellent! Frank Gari was a genius when he first came up with the idea and pitched it to WISN. Thanks to ch 12, "Hello Milwaukee" was the first in a long line of Hello ad campaigns. WTAE and "Hello Pittsburgh" almost beat us to being first.
